chore: remove dead code identified by vulture + coverage cross-validation
Remove unused code confirmed dead via vulture scan, grep verification, and coverage analysis: - _get_bridge_dir (cli/commands.py): 82-line function with zero callers - add_assistant_message (agent/context.py): method body never executed, also removed now-unused build_assistant_message import - _tool_parameters_schema (agent/tools/base.py): redundant copy of schema already exposed via the `parameters` property - MSTEAMS_REF_TTL_S (channels/msteams.py): unused constant (production uses config.ref_ttl_days directly); inlined in test - MESSAGE_TYPE_USER (channels/weixin.py): unused constant
